Modern Audi cars feature a steel switchblade and a keyless entry, or advanced key, as well as an immobilizer chip inside. The switchblade is responsible for controlling the physical door locks and the ignition cylinder. The keyless entry or advanced key sends a message to the immobilizer to begin the car. The immobilizer chip is a small round glass pill that is activated when the key is within the range of the vehicle.

There are numerous kinds of Audi keys and each one comes with its own set of features and functions. The classic Audi key is an actual physical key that must be manually put in and then turned to start the car. These keys are found in older models and could require replacement if they become damaged or inoperable.

A smart-key fob is another kind of Audi key that utilizes a chip transponder to lock and unlock doors as well as the trunk. This technology is more secure than a conventional key and can even protect against theft. Smart-key fobs must be programmed to work with your vehicle.
